So an NFL player and an NBA player walk into a bar… and they both end up getting arrested for fighting each other.
St. Louis Rams linebacker Jo-Lonn Dunbar and NBA free agent Donté Greene both got cuffed after getting into an altercation early Sunday morning outside Dream nightclub in Miami Beach.
Details are still hazy, but apparently the two got into a fight outside the club. No one else was arrested in the altercation.
Both were charged with disorderly conduct and battery and both had bailed out by late Sunday.

Dunbar is a starter for the Rams and won a Super Bowl with the New Orleans Saints in 2009.
Greene, a native of Germany, most recently played in the Summer League for the Brooklyn Nets.
